Client Invoices for Invoice Ninja


Client Invoices for Invoice Ninja Module connects your Joomla site to your Invoice Ninja v5 instance and shows each logged-in user their own invoices.

This module is ideal for agencies, freelancers, and service businesses that use Invoice Ninja and want a simple, branded client billing area inside Joomla.

Features (Free Edition)
Displays a list of invoices for the logged-in Joomla user
“View / Pay” buttons that link to your Invoice Ninja client portal
Option to hide zero-balance invoices
Basic caching of API responses to reduce load
Simple configuration: just enter your Invoice Ninja base URL and API token
Requirements
Joomla 4 or Joomla 5
Invoice Ninja v5 (self-hosted) with API access enabled
This extension is developed by Cane Tree Corp as a third-party integration. It is not affiliated with or endorsed by the Invoice Ninja project or its developers.

A separate Pro version is available with additional features such as auto-login invitation links, a “Email me a secure portal link” button with configurable strategy, connection test tools, and 1 year of updates and priority support. The Free version is fully functional and GPL-licensed.

Extension Info :

Display your clients’ Invoice Ninja v5 invoices inside Joomla. Logged-in users can see their own invoices and click through to view or pay them in your Invoice Ninja portal.

Extension Data :

  • Latest Version1.3.0
  • DeveloperDaniel McNulty
  • Last Updated20251216
  • Date Published20251117
  • TypeFree download
  • Compatibility :
  • Joomla 3.xYes
  • Joomla 4.xYes
  • Joomla 5.xYes
  • Joomla 6.xYes

Find Similar Extensions